Funeral arrangements announced for deputy allegedly killed by man who led authorities on chase, crashed on live TV

Video above: KTLA coverage from Oct. 29 of a vigil for Deputy Andrew Nunez in Rancho Cucamonga, which was attended by over 1,000 people.

Funeral arrangements for Deputy Andrew Nunez, who was shot and killed by an alleged gunman who led authorities on a motorcycle chase and crashed in an incident caught live on TV last month, have been announced.

The San Bernardino County Sheriff’s Department stated that funeral services would be held on Tuesday at Toyota Arena in Ontario…
